Output 53a13d788f88e16ee25bcfef0053e95b0f95ccd2fa7584578b1ed830f7965de0:0

value
3070000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b16a156086e5ce315173a8a3c0789b1bca714aa3 OP_EQUAL
address
3Hs6cJs8zRWasY4HAEfhewYgaJghUC3y5R
transaction
53a13d788f88e16ee25bcfef0053e95b0f95ccd2fa7584578b1ed830f7965de0
confirmations
529077
spent
true